Whether or not to train to failure – the inability to perform another repetition with proper form – has long been debated. Dr. Schoenfeld stresses the importance of lifting with a lot of effort but describes research that suggests failure training may not build hypertrophy and may even be detrimental to strength.

For most people, stopping a few reps short of failure may have better effects on maximizing strength; however, some failure training may be worthwhile for bodybuilders. In this clip, Dr. Brad Schoenfeld discusses balancing effort and rest to optimize muscle hypertrophy and strength gains.
